Obituary Notice: Brian M. McCann

Brian Michael McCann, 49, of Curwensville died Thursday, Oct. 20, 2016 at his residence.

Born Oct. 7, 1967 in Greenville, he was the son of Regis F. and Doris (Diefendiefer) McCann.

Mr. McCann was currently working at Rescar in DuBois in the parts department and the office.

He previously had worked as a truck driver for Conway Freight in Woodland.  He was Christian by faith.

He wed the former Ali Kay Lewis on Feb. 5, 2011, who survives, along with two children, Brandon M. McCann and his wife, Heather of Atlantic, Pa., and Jessica A. McCann and her significant other, Thomas Alabran of Greenville, Pa., and three step-children, Olivia P. Charles and her fiancé, Codey Blantz and Logen A. Charles, both of Mississippi, and Christopher A. Charles at home.

Also surviving are two grandchildren, Mason M. McCann and Colton I. Alabran; a brother and a sister, Bruce E. McCann and his wife, Darlene of Greenville, Pa., and Sherry A. Cooley and her husband, Spencer of Atlantic, Pa.; as well as numerous aunts, uncles and cousins.

He was preceded in death by his parents.

Funeral services for Brian McCann will be held at 11 a.m. Tuesday at the Chester C. Chidboy Funeral Home Inc. of Curwensville with Pastor Roger McGary officiating. Burial will be in the Bloomington Cemetery Curwensville.

Friends will be received from 2 p.m. – 4 p.m. and 6 p.m. – 8 p.m. Monday and again from 10 a.m. – 11 a.m. Tuesday at the funeral home.

The family suggests contributions be made to the American Heart Association, 610 Community Way, Lancaster, PA 17603.

Online condolences may be made to the family at www.chidboyfuneralhome.com.

The Chester C. Chidboy Funeral Home Inc. of Curwensville is in charge of the arrangements.
